South African vs Immigrants from Argentina Master's Degree Correlation Chart
The statistical analysis conducted on geographies consisting of 182,576,527 people shows a weak negative correlation between the proportion of South Africans and percentage of population with at least master's degree education in the United States with a correlation coefficient (R) of -0.218 and weighted average of 18.1%. Similarly, the statistical analysis conducted on geographies consisting of 264,373,397 people shows no correlation between the proportion of Immigrants from Argentina and percentage of population with at least master's degree education in the United States with a correlation coefficient (R) of -0.016 and weighted average of 18.0%, a difference of 0.78%.
